Subject: [TEGRA194_CPUFREQ Patch v3 4/4] arm64: defconfig: Enable CONFIG_ARM_TEGRA194_CPUFREQ
Date: Mon, 22 Jun 2020 03:04:34 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1592775274-27513-5-git-send-email-sumitg@nvidia.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1592775274-27513-1-git-send-email-sumitg@nvidia.com>
Enable Tegra194 CPU frequency scaling support by default.
Signed-off-by: Sumit Gupta <sumitg@nvidia.com>
---
arch/arm64/configs/defconfig |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/configs/defconfig b/arch/arm64/configs/defconfig
index f9d378d..385bd35 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/configs/defconfig
+++ b/arch/arm64/configs/defconfig
@@ -91,6 +91,7 @@ CONFIG_ARM_QCOM_CPUFREQ_NVMEM=y
CONFIG_ARM_QCOM_CPUFREQ_HW=y
CONFIG_ARM_RASPBERRYPI_CPUFREQ=m
CONFIG_ARM_TEGRA186_CPUFREQ=y
+CONFIG_ARM_TEGRA194_CPUFREQ=y
CONFIG_QORIQ_CPUFREQ=y
CONFIG_ARM_SCPI_PROTOCOL=y
CONFIG_RASPBERRYPI_FIRMWARE=y
